The Challenge

A 20+ year-old commercial shop lot in Jalan Raja Laut was undergoing a full refurbishment to be repurposed into an Airbnb unit. As part of the upgrade, the client required a vertical lift system spanning from Ground Floor to Level 4. This involved structural slab removal across 5 floors to accommodate a 1.6m × 1.45m elevator shaft. Given the age of the building and the absence of reliable as-built drawings, there were concerns about column alignment and the added weight of new installations, including a rooftop water tank.

Our Approach & Result

We first conducted a structural assessment using Xradar™ to accurately locate internal columns and verify safe zones for cutting across level 1 to level 4. With this data, we used Diamond Wall Saws to create clean, vibration-free slab openings across all 5 levels. To ensure structural integrity, we then carried out beam strengthening around the shaft from Level 1 to Level 4.

On the rooftop, additional strengthening was done to support a new water tank, including the installation of new columns and a dedicated footing system running down to the ground floor.

In the heart of Kuala Lumpur, a 2 decade-old commercial lot was being renovated into a multi-storey Airbnb.

Before any reconstruction, the client engaged us to carry out concrete scanning using Xradar™. We mapped the internal layout, locating the positions of key columns from Level 1 To Level 4. This ensured that the proposed elevator shaft, measuring 1.6m × 1.45m, could be installed safely without affecting the surrounding structure.

With the scanned data in hand, our team used Diamond Wall Saws to cut precise openings through the reinforced slabs from Ground Floor up to Level 4. The method produced minimal vibration and dust, making it ideal for a live site with multiple trades working in tandem.

Once the openings were completed, our scope moved to structural strengthening. We reinforced the slab areas surrounding the lift shaft from Level 1 to Level 4 to safely accommodate the new load. The client also planned to install a water tank at the rooftop level so we proceed with installing new columns and cast a new footing system all the way to the Ground Floor to ensure full load transfer and long-term stability.
